Indian River Trail Report – 12/12

Sounds like some areas to our West and South were hammered by snow over the weekend. I wish we could say the same in our area but we can’t. We did get snow over the weekend and have between 6″-8″ total on the ground. The numbers increase as you move west from the center of town. Lake effect is tough to measure because it often varies within a couple mile radius of any spot. Make no mistake–winter is here! We just don’t have enough snow to run tractors/drags over yet. One day at a time. Temps were in the teens and low 20’s over the weekend. Today we’re up in the high 20’s and should top out around freezing. Looks like a quiet day ahead and all local schools are open because the roads are fairly clear. Assuming the forecast holds we’re in for a big temperature drop and by Wednesday (highs in the teens). We’re also in for snow every day, starting tomorrow. Stay tuned and we’ll keep you updated with the latest and greatest.

Benzie Area Trail Report – 12/12

Hey all! Monday Monday! Well, we have snow! BUT not quite enough to groom yet and it won’t pack well yet since its the light and fluffy stuff. We have gotten anywhere from 3-8′ of LE snow first, then yesterday, system snow, but more to the South than us. Still about 6′ or so down, some areas more, some less. Yes, there’s snow but NO, it’s not much so it’s easy to stir up that dirt out there so take it easy if you do go out. We are supposed to get some pretty good snow again later in the week so hopefully enough for the groomers! Until then they won’t be out.
